In the early 1900s, an alternative word for barber, "chirotonsor", entered into use in the U.S. Different states in the US vary on their labor and licensing regulations. In Maryland and Pennsylvania, a cosmetologist can not utilize a straight razor, strictly booked for barbers. In comparison, in New Jacket both are managed by the State Board of Cosmetology and there is no more a lawful difference in barbers and cosmetologists, as they are released the exact same license and can practice both the art of straight razor shaving, tinting, other chemical job and haircutting if they choose. In ancient Egyptian society, barbers were very valued individuals. Priests and males of medicine are the earliest tape-recorded instances of barbers. Additionally, the art of barbering played a considerable role throughout continents. Mayan, Aztec, Iroquois, Norse and Mongolian cultures utilized cut art as a method to distinguish roles in culture and war time.

The barbers utilized a rough cloth () on their shoulders to maintain the hairs off their gowns. There were also female barbers (). Barbering was introduced to Rome by the Greek colonies in Sicily in 296 BC, [] and hair salons (Latin:, lit. "clipperies") quickly ended up being preferred centers for day-to-day news and chatter.
A couple of Roman barbers prospered and influential, running stores that rated public areas of upper class. The majority of, nevertheless, were basic tradespersons who had small shops or worked in the roads for affordable price.
